Wirtgen Group Maintenance Expert
1 week ago
The Wirtgen Group is a renowned manufacturer of construction machinery. Our product portfolio includes mobile machines for road construction and rehabilitation, plants for mining and processing minerals or recycling material, and asphalt production.
We are seeking an experienced Field Service Technician to join our team in Auckland, New Zealand. The successful candidate will be responsible for ensuring the optimal performance and efficiency of our equipment.
Key Responsibilities:- Maintenance and repair of mobile machinery and equipment
- Routine maintenance checks and inspections
- Collaboration with colleagues to resolve technical issues
Requirements:
- Strong technical knowledge and experience in mechanical engineering
- Ability to work independently and as part of a team
- Familiarity with industry-standard software and tools
What We Offer:
- A competitive salary and benefits package
- Ongoing training and professional development opportunities
- A collaborative and dynamic work environment
